是什么使某些EXIF标签不可写?

时间:2019-02-10 18:45:05

标签: exif id3 exiftool

某些EXIF标签,例如here中列出的许多QuickTime标签,是普通EXIF编辑器不可写的。

This list的可写与不可写由Phil Harvey的exiftool维护,但是我发现尝试使用其他工具(例如MetaClean)编辑相同标签的结果相似。重新加载文件后,我对这些标签的编辑不会继续,并且原始值会返回。

那是为什么?某个标签会使其变为不可编辑状态,有什么手动方法可以覆盖它吗?

1 个答案:

答案 0 :(得分:1)

首先,您链接的标签不是EXIF标签,它们是Quicktime标签。 EXIF只是所有类型的元数据的常见但狭窄的子集。很抱歉成为一个学究的驴子。

就exiftool而言,尤其是视频文件而言,如Tag Harvey(exiftool的作者)所说,此类标签的标准和格式是一团糟。各种程序和相机如何实现此类元数据显然存在很多差异。菲尔(Phil)觉得他没有时间对所有各种差异和边缘情况进行故障排除。举个例子,他最近开始在视频文件中添加对gps曲目的读取支持。这最终导致必须支持20多种不同的地理轨迹。那只是为了阅读。

后续活动:从exiftool版本11.39开始,更有用的标签中的a number已可写。尽管它们仍然属于Quicktime组,但Exiftool现在将它们列在ItemList组下,而不是Quicktime下。